Revenue Business Model Raw Material/Finished Products Diversified supply of raw material Approximately 75% of our raw material is procured under a processing agreement, whereby margins are established and the risk is shared. The balance is a “fee for service” business. 28.74% 10.10% 24.27% 5.76% 9.65% 19.71% 1.77% Beef Pork Poultry Grocery Used Cooking Oil Bakery Other 15

A Significant Portion has a “Built-In Margin” How We Buy It Darling Formula Pricing Example Industry has evolved to a shared risk procurement model Pricing protocols reduce exposure to commodity price fluctuation and provide minimum margins Raw materials procured under the following pricing arrangements: o Formula-based rendering (~70% of total raw material volume) o Used cooking oil (~45% of total raw material volume) o Bakery residual is 100% formula tied to corn (profit share) Product Finished price Total yield Animal Fats $40.00cwt 26% Protein Meals $20.00cwt 22% Note: Yield is based on individual supplier’s historical yields and is adjusted as needed Product Finished price Total yield Value Animal Fats $40.00cwt 26% $10.40 Protein Meals $20.00cwt 22% $ 4.40 Finished product sales value $14.80 Darling conversion cost with Energy adjuster ($6.00) Darling fixed margin ($1.50) Total processing cost ($7.50) (Charge) / Rebate to supplier per cwt $7.30 Source: Company Management Note: When finished product sales value covers Darling’s cost and fixed spread, a rebate to the supplier is generated. Conversely, when the finished product sales value is less than Darling’s cost and fixed spread, the supplier is charged for the difference. Hampton Extraction Plant Secondary protein nutrients (SPN), also called dissolved air flotation (DAF) float or skimming's, is a wastewater byproduct that is produced by the poultry industry. Today a majority of this product is land applied. We estimate several billion pounds of this product is available annually. SPN is evaporated in Dublin, GA Trucked to Hampton for extraction Protein and oil are separated Sold as animal feed and fat 31

DGD Margin Foundation How the margins are created RFS2 Mandates Requires minimum annual production of 1 million gallons of biomass-based diesel (ie, biodiesel or renewable diesel only). Renewable RIN valued higher than biodiesel RIN (1.7 vs 1.5) Renewable diesel can be distributed through existing infrastructure (pipeline, tanks, etc). Biodiesel cannot. Renewable Diesel refining process can efficiently use lower cost feed stock (requires specialized pretreatment) Renewable diesel is a superior fuel to biodiesel (for example, no cold- flow issues that biodiesel has) Diamond Green Diesel plant benefits from multiple synergies from its location adjacent to the Valero St. Charles Refinery Renewable Diesel co-products are more valuable than those from biodiesel Renewable Diesel cash processing costs are competitive with biodiesel Diamond Green Diesel is in the right geographic location for: feedstock flow, access to markets for finished product, transportation access Distribution Lower $ Feed Stock Superior Fuel Synergies Co- Products Costs Location 37
